It has deep characters, with believable personalities. The series takes about 8 whole episodes to catch on, but when it does, you'll be longing for the next episode. The story starts with a girl running off with a suitcase in a bag. The suitcase holds the Faiz gear, and she mistakes her bag with the one of the main character. They quarrel over the bag, but once they sorted it out, the girl is attacked by a creature, called Orphnoc, and try to use the belt to transform. Since she is unable to transform, she buckles the belt onto the main character, who is able to transform, and sticks around to protect the girl, even against his will. From there, the series introduces great characters for every side: heroes, villains, anti-heroes. The main problem is the rushed end of the series, and that interferes in the way some characters behave. Apart from that, this series is highly recommended for the fans of the franchise.
